Hardware requirements—web servers, application servers, and single server installations
The values in the following table are minimum values for installations on a single server with a built-in database and for web and application servers that are running SharePoint 2013 Preview in a multiple server farm installation. For information about the deployment types that are used in this table, see the SharePoint 2010 Products: Deployment model. You can download this model from the Installation and deployment for SharePoint 2013 IT Pros Resource Center.
For all installation scenarios, you must have sufficient hard disk space for the base installation and sufficient space for diagnostics such as logging, debugging, creating memory dumps, and so on. For production use, you must also have additional free disk space for day-to-day operations. In addition, maintain two times as much free space as you have RAM for production environments. Installation Scenario | Deployment type and scale | RAM | Processor | Hard disk space |
---|---|---|---|---|
Single server with a built-in database or single server that uses SQL Server | Development or evaluation installation of SharePoint Foundation 2013 Preview | 8 GB | 64-bit, 4 cores | 80 GB for system drive |
Single server with a built-in database or single server that uses SQL Server | Development or evaluation installation of SharePoint Server 2013 Preview | 24 GB | 64-bit, 4 cores | 80 GB for system drive |
Web server or application server in a three-tier farm | Pilot, user acceptance test, or production deployment of SharePoint Server 2013 Preview | 12 GB | 64-bit, 4 cores | 80 GB for system drive |

Prerequisite installer operations and command-line options
The SharePoint 2013 Preview prerequisite installer (prerequisiteinstaller.exe) installs the following software, if it has not already been installed on the target server, in this order:
- Microsoft .NET Framework version 4.5 Release Candidate (RC)
- Windows Management Framework 3.0 Release Candidate (RC)
- Application Server Role, Web Server (IIS) Role
- Microsoft SQL Server 2008 R2 SP1 Native Client
- Windows Identity Foundation (KB974405)
- Microsoft Sync Framework Runtime v1.0 SP1 (x64)
- Windows Identity Extensions
- Microsoft Information Protection and Control Client
- Microsoft WCF Data Services 5.0
- Windows Server AppFabric
- Cumulative Update Package 1 for Microsoft AppFabric 1.1 for Windows Server (KB 2671763)
- /? Display command-line options
- /continue This is used to tell the installer that it is continuing from a restart
- /unattended No user interaction
- /SQLNCli:<file> Install Microsoft SQL Server 2008 SP1 Native Client from <file>
- /PowerShell:<file> Install Windows Management Framework 3.0 Release Candidate (RC) from <file>
- /NETFX:<file> Install Microsoft .NET Framework version 4.5 from <file>
- /IDFX:<file> Install Windows Identity Foundation (KB974405) from <file>
- /IDFX11:<file> Install Windows Identity Foundation v1.1 from <file>
- /Sync:<file> Install Microsoft Sync Framework Runtime SP1 v1.0 (x64) from <file>
- /AppFabric:<file> Install Windows Server AppFabric from <file> (AppFabric must be installed with the options /i CacheClient,CachingService,CacheAdmin /gac)
- /KB2671763:<file> Install Microsoft AppFabric 1.1 for Windows Server (AppFabric 1.1) from <file>
- /MSIPCClient:<file> Install Microsoft Information Protection and Control Client from <file>
- /WCFDataServices:<file> Install Microsoft WCF Data Services from <file>
Installation options
Certain prerequisites are installed by the prerequisite installer with specific options. Those prerequisites with specific installation options are listed below with the options used by the prerequisite installer.
.
- Windows AppFabric
/i CacheClient,CachingService,CacheAdmin /gac
- Microsoft WCF Data Services
/quiet
